Page 3: Glory through Suffering The journey to glory follows the path of suffering.

Php. 2:1-2 (ESV)“So if there is any encouragement in Christ,

any comfort from love, any participation in the Spirit, any affection and sympathy,

complete my joy by being of the same mind, having the same love, being in full accord and of one mind.

Page 4: Glory through Suffering The journey to glory follows the path of suffering.

Php. 2:3-4 (ESV)“Do nothing from selfish ambition or conceit, but in humility count others more significant than yourselves. Let each of you look not only to his own interests, but also to the interests of others.”

Page 5: Glory through Suffering The journey to glory follows the path of suffering.

Php. 2:5-6 (Paraphrase)“Adopt then this frame of mind in your community—which indeed [is proper for those who are] in Christ Jesus.Though he existed in the form of God, Christ took no advantage of his equality with God.

Page 6: Glory through Suffering The journey to glory follows the path of suffering.

Php. 2:7-8 (Paraphrase)“Instead, he made himself nothing by assuming the form of a servant, that is, by becoming incarnate. And having appeared as a mere man, he further humbled himself by becoming obedient to the point of death—and no less than the death of the cross.

Page 7: Glory through Suffering The journey to glory follows the path of suffering.

Php. 2:9-11 (Paraphrase)“For this very reason God has exalted him above all things by granting to him as a gift the name that is above every name, so that the whole universe may bow in adoration before the name of Jesus— indeed, so that every tongue may confess that Jesus Christ is the divine Lord, for the glory of God the Father.”
